Timber Retaining Wall Repair in Lakewood

Preserving Natural Strength and Beauty

Timber retaining walls offer both functional support and aesthetic appeal to landscapes. Over time, these structures may face challenges due to environmental exposure, material degradation, or structural stress. Addressing these issues promptly ensures the longevity and safety of your retaining wall.​

Recognizing prevalent problems can aid in early detection and timely intervention.

  • Wood Rot and Decay: Exposure to moisture can lead to fungal growth, causing the timber to weaken and deteriorate.​
  • Insect Infestation: Pests such as termites can compromise the structural integrity of the wood.​
  • Leaning or Tilting: Soil pressure or inadequate anchoring can cause the wall to lean outward.​
  • Cracking and Splitting: Environmental factors like temperature fluctuations can cause the wood to crack or split.​
  • Poor Drainage Leading to Soil Erosion: Inadequate drainage can result in water buildup behind the wall, increasing pressure and causing soil erosion.​

Potential Risks of Ignoring Timber Wall Damage

Neglecting necessary repairs can lead to more severe consequences.

  • Structural Failure: Minor issues can escalate, resulting in partial or complete wall collapse, posing safety hazards.​
  • Landscape Damage: A failing wall can lead to soil erosion, affecting the surrounding landscape and plantings.​
  • Increased Repair Costs: Delaying repairs often results in more extensive damage, making future repairs more complex and expensive.​

Professional Solutions for Timber Retaining Wall Repair

Addressing timber wall issues requires tailored solutions based on the specific problem and its severity.

  • Replacing Damaged Sections: Removing and replacing rotted or infested timber to restore structural integrity.​
  • Improving Drainage Systems: Installing proper drainage solutions, such as gravel backfill and perforated pipes, to prevent water accumulation behind the wall.​
  • Installing Anchors or Deadmen: Adding support structures to stabilize and straighten leaning walls.​
  • Applying Protective Treatments: Control plant growth near the wall to prevent root intrusion and additional pressure on the structure.​
  • Reinforcing with Steel Rods or Braces: Adding additional support to strengthen weakened sections of the wall.​

Preventative Measures to Maintain Timber Wall Integrity

Proactive steps can extend the lifespan of your timber retaining wall and minimize future repair needs.

  • Regular Inspections: Conduct periodic assessments to identify and address minor issues before they escalate.​
  • Ensuring Proper Drainage: Maintain clear drainage paths to prevent water buildup behind the wall.​
  • Using Treated Timber: Opt for pressure-treated wood to resist decay and insect damage.​
  • Applying Protective Coatings: Regularly apply sealants to shield the wood from moisture and environmental damage.​
  • Managing Vegetation: Keep plant growth near the wall in check to prevent root intrusion and additional pressure on the structure.​
